Fabrizio Romano says Cedric Soares will leave Arsenal

Cedric Soares joined Arsenal on an initial loan deal from Southampton in January 2020. That move was made permanent in the following summer.

The Portugal international, branded as ‘fantastic’ by Gilberto Silva, was never the first choice at the Emirates. He has played 64 times for the Gunners in all competitions, but Mikel Arteta has only ever viewed him as a backup.

Since the start of last season, Cedric has barely played. He spent the second half of last season on loan at Fulham and has been given less than an hour of game time in the Premier League this time around.

It was always expected that Cedric would leave Arsenal on a free transfer this summer, and Fabrizio Romano has just confirmed that the decision has been made.

The journalist also adds that there are ‘many clubs in Europe’ interested in signing Cedric before the start of next season.

Romano tweeted a few moments ago: “Cédric Soares will leave Arsenal as free agent in the summer, decision made.

“Portuguese RB remains fully committed to the club until June as top professional then he will leave #AFC. Many clubs in Europe, considering Cédric as a top option for the summer on free transfer.”
